Technical Considerations and Fabric Compatibility

While the visual appeal is strong, no designer can ignore the technical realities of stitching. Xoxo PNG Design presents specific challenges depending on where and how you apply it. For instance, using this design on textured fabrics requires careful planning. If the base material has a heavy weave or a plush pile, the fine details of the design may get lost. In such cases, you might need to adjust the stitch density or opt for a different type of stabilizer to ensure the threads lay flat and crisp.

Stretchy fabrics, such as jersey knits often used in t-shirt designs, demand extra caution. Without proper stabilization, the hoop marks can leave permanent indentations, and the tension variations can cause puckering. I recommend testing the design on scrap fabric first to dial in the correct tension settings. Additionally, dark fabrics present a contrast challenge. Depending on the thread colors chosen, the design might lose its definition against a black or navy background. Always inspect small details by converting the design to black and white mockups to ensure legibility across various colorways.

Curved surfaces, like caps, add another layer of complexity. The curvature can distort straight lines and alter the perceived proportions of the text. If you plan to use this for embroidered patches or hat front panels, you must account for the distortion factor. It is also worth noting that dense stitch areas can make the fabric stiff. If the end product needs to remain soft and pliable, such as a baby blanket or a lightweight tea towel, you should review the fill stitch settings to reduce bulk where possible.
